The characters of the HBO and HBO Max smash hit series The Pittare back on call for a new season, coming in the next few months.
At the end of last month, Warner Bros. offered an early look at Season 3 of the award-winning medical drama, with a new teaser for the upcoming episodes. In a discussion with Deadline, lead actor Noah Wyle said that “Season 3 is about doctors benefiting from being patients. We’re going to see that [Robby]’s begun the therapeutic road; it’s had a positive effect.”
Here’s what we know about Season 3 so far, including its release date, episode count, and scheduling.
‘The Pitt’ Season 3 Release Window, Explained
Warner Bros. Discovery, the parent company behind HBO and HBO Max, has previously confirmed in a press release that The Pitt “will return for its third season in January 2027.” While the company didn’t state when exactly in January the series would return, a little look into the history of the series (with a pinch of mathematics) can determine a near-certain date for its return.
Season 1 of the Pittpremiered on January 9, 2025, and Season 2’s first episode debuted on January 8, 2026, making an early January release the most likely. What’s more is that both seasons 1 and 2 premiered on a Thursday, as part of an episode-per-week rollout.
With this in mind, looking into the calendar of January 2027, the first Thursday of the month is January 7, 2027, making it the most likely premiere date for The PittSeason 3. What’s more is that HBO has confirmed that Season 3, like the previous 2 seasons, will consist of 15 episodes, which will air weekly. Should Season 3 air one episode per week (or two episodes in its first week, like Season 1) from January 7, then the season should conclude around mid-late April, approximately in keeping with Seasons 1 and 2.
While it should be underlined that neither HBO nor HBO Max has yet confirmed the exact premiere date of January 7, previously established patterns make the date almost certain, unless the HBO network undergoes some significant scheduling changes.
